2013-10-21 16:32:26EDF says between £2-£2.50/MWh of price is for decommissioning costs... capped at £3/MWh and any difference passed through to the consumers.

2013-10-21 16:43:08EDF will make final investment decision by July 2014. Hinkley C expected to complete commissioning of the first unit in 2023.
